Hawaii wide receiver Jackson Harris revealed on social media that he visited LSU on Saturday.

Harris just wrapped up his redshirt sophomore season, catching 49 passes for 963 yards and 12 touchdowns.

The 6-3, 190-pounder from Berkeley, Calif., spent his first two seasons at Stanford.
